WebJul 12, 2024 · More: These are that 56 people which signed one Declaration of Independence About the essay gets wrong "Five signers was captured by the British as traitors, and tormented before they died." It’s true that five signers were captured — George Walton, Thomas Heyward Jr., Arthur Middleton, Edward Rutledge and Richard Stockton.
